Mission Statement: To support effective learning in the schools, the School - Based Health Center addresses student and family physical, social and emotional well-being.

The School-Based Health Center has the overall goal to improve the mental and physical health and educational success of students who attend the elementary, middle and high schools of St. Bernard-Elmwood Place City School District. Additionally, in order to respond to community needs, we have the goal of providing primary care services to all residents of the two communities.

The Center is housed in Elmwood Place Elementary
